Read MoreThe climate depends on many factors: latitude, long-term atmospheric and ocean circulation patterns, elevation, closeness to large water bodies and mountains, etc. Jointly, these factors influence the range of temperatures and the quantity of rain or snow each area obtains through the year and, accordingly, the spatial arrangement of biomes.
Read MoreEvery country that shared a border with Poland in 1989 has since disappeared or transformed completely. East Germany, Czechoslovakia, and the Soviet Union—three powerful neighbors that seemed permanent—all vanished within just a few years, fundamentally reshaping Poland’s place in Europe and the world.
